The Sixth District Court of Appeal recently issued its published decision in the case of Orozco v. WPV (cite) . The Appellate Court upheld a jury verdict holding one of the largest real estate entities in the Country as lessor (represented by one of the largest law firms in the Country) liable to the leasee for lost profit and other damages based on fraud and concealment. The underlying real estate matter involved the lease of restaurant space in a retail center. In addition to upholding the jury verdict, the Appellate Court held that the guarantor of the lease was entitled to rescission of the guarantee and an award of damages.
